    7. 26-May-12 Adabas v5.1 for Open Systems V5.1 Features MU and PE occurrences higher than 191 (32k) Non Descriptor Search capability UNICODE Support Long Alpha (LA option) Fields 16k Descriptors can be upto 1142 bytes

    8. 26-May-12 Adabas v5.1 for Open Systems V5.1 Features LF Command For mainframe compatability SQL DDL support - Create/Drop Table/Column Record counter for SQL Support Faster processing of SELECT COUNT(*) FROM TABLENAME Number of records stored in FCB Backward Compression Main/Upper Indices

    9. 26-May-12 Adabas v5.1 for Open Systems V5.1 Features No limit on File extents SQL CREATE TABLE does not require size Dynamic Hold Queue Tolerate Corrupted Index Rsp code 48 if index is accessed

    10. 26-May-12 Adabas v5.1 for Open Systems V5.1 Features WORK dataset reorganization Part 2 & 3 are combined Parameters removed Allocated from temporary working space WORK is used for Part 1 processing only LP parameter removed Unlimited SORT space for S2/S9 LS parameter removed

    11. 26-May-12 Adabas v5.1 for Open Systems V5.1 Features Automatic extension of temporary Work space Nucleus or Utilities, SORT and TEMP used Dynamically allocated and released Automatic container file extensions ASSO/DATA Expands last extent or New container created ADANUC/ADADBM

    12. 26-May-12 Adabas v5.1 for Open Systems V5.1 Features Utility Changes ADACMP ADADBM ADADCU ADAFDU ADAFRM ADANUC

    15. 26-May-12 Adabas for z/OS When transferring the Container and Copy.Job file from Windows to z/OS with FTP, then modify the COPY.JOB as follow: Change SAGLIB to a valid high level qualifier Change USER to a current UserID

    16. 26-May-12 Adabas for VSE

    17. 26-May-12 Adabas for VSE Insert CD into CD drive, suppose D: Start Virtual Tape Server on PC On VSE; job TAPESRVR which handles the virtual tape must be on reader queue Jobs which access the AWSTAPE file should include statements to handle virtual tape DVCDN 192 VTAPE START,UNIT=192,LOC=111.111.111.111:2386, X FILE='D:/SAG.T76211',READ DVCUP 192

    18. 26-May-12 Adabas for VSE FTP file SAG.COPY.JOB to VSE Change JCS before submitting job SAGLIB with the name of the library 192 with CUU of virtual tape device 111.111.111.111 with TCPIP address of PC

    20. 26-May-12 Adabas v8 An Adabas V8 nucleus will support and execute all features as supported by a V74 nucleus

    21. 26-May-12 Adabas v8 New Features Lifting Repeating Field Limits Lifting Record Limits Lifting Extent Limits New Field Formats Enhanced Direct Call Interface Adabas System Manager

    22. 26-May-12 Lifting Repeating Field limits MU/PE limits Increase to 2 bytes - 191 to 65,535 occurrences Occurs at the file level Count field in Index Block increased by one byte; re-invert would be required for PE descriptors New Hyper-exit required for expanded MU/PE count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    23. 26-May-12 Lifting Repeating Field limits MU/PE limits may result in: Larger records not fitting into one data storage block or The LWP (Work Pool) size definition may need to be increased to accommodate the update a higher count of occurrences. The LP (WORK Part 1) size definition may need to be increased to accommodate the large number of occurrences. The LFP (Internal Format Pool ) size definition may need to be increased because the Internal Format Element has increased. The total format may be as large as 2G.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    24. 26-May-12 Lifting Record Limits Large Record Support Compressed Record may exceed one physical Data Storage Block Optional feature that would be set at the file level Logical record will be split at the field level Data Storage will reflect an Expanded Record Primary Record allocated as always Secondary Records allocated with different AC extents Secondary ISN allocation transparent to the application FCB to reflect both AC allocations Impact on the FCB for AC allocations Segment of a logical record may be read/updated independent of other records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    26. 26-May-12 Lifting Record Limits Large Record Support Physical sequential commands will automatically skip the secondary records in the data storage. Read by ISN will be unaffected Primary records are included in top ISN and MAX-ISN. Maximum Record Length, specified for a file, will have no relevance for file supporting this feature. Utilities that report on maximum record length will now state n/a. ISN settings for the utility (e.g. MIN-ISN option with Load) will refer to the primary ISNs only (NOT secondary) Primary ISNs will be counted from MINISN to MAXISN, and secondary ISNs will be counted from MINSEC to MAXSEC A larger NISNHQ parameter may need to be specified for doing updates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    27. 26-May-12 Lifting Record Limits Large Record Support Segmentation is done by field unless this is not feasible. Segmentation by byte is done for long alpha fields and long wide fields. All utilities that use compressed or uncompressed data are enhanced to support spanning of the logical record across multiple records on the operating system files. need to be increased since space is needed to store both the before and after image of the spanned record. This can also be for several update threads running in parallel. Space to accommodate a large DVT is also needed (up to 65K occurrences permitted).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    28. 26-May-12 Lifting Field Limits Large Object Field Types Single field up to 2G in size Fields may contain any type of date, example: Jpegs AVI files PPT, XCL Large documents Images Fingerprints Separate file entity for LOB field types Requires change to ACB Support for segmented Buffers Permit Length optimization with communication protocol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    30. 26-May-12 Lifting Field Limits Large Object Field Types May have any of the options NU, NC, NN, NV, NB, or MU. NV-option (no conversion) specifies that no conversion is to occur NB-option (no blank compression) for alphanumeric or wide character fields NC-option (SQL Null Value) for Field may contain a null value NN-option (SQL not Null) for Field defined with NC option must always have a value defined Cannot have the options FI (fixed) or LA (long alpha). Cannot be a descriptor or a parent of a special (phonetic, sub-, super-, or hyper-) descriptor. Cannot be specified in a search buffer. May be part of a simple group or a PE-group.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    31. 26-May-12 Lifting Field Limits Large Object Field Types Example FDT: 1,L1,0,A,LB,NU ? null-suppressed character LOB 1,L2,0,A,LB,NV,NB,MU ? multiple-value binary LOB 1,GR,PE ? periodic group 2,L3,0,W,LB,MU,NU ? null-suppressed multiple-value wide character LOB in PE-group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    32. 26-May-12 Lifting Field Limits Large Object Field Types Example Format Buffer FB=L1. ? LOB field L1 FB=L21. ? Occ 1 of multiple-value LOB field L2 FB=L1,50000,AA,10,A. ? 50,000 bytes for L1, + 10 bytes for AA FB=L1,0,AA,10,A. ? 4-byte length of L1, + L1 field, + AA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    33. 26-May-12 Large Object Field Types Length specification New Format Buffer Option xxL xxL in the format buffer returns the compressed field length in binary format Rules: AAL has to be defined in front of AA. AAL can occur as a single field with/without field AA. AAL definition in an update format buffer is ignored. Example: FB=L1L,4,B. ? length element for LOB field L1 FB=L2L1,4,B. ? length element for first value of multiple- value LOB field L2 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    38. 26-May-12 FDT Changes May be larger than 4 blocks Will move from the fixed area to the dynamic area in Asso Increase Field Definition Element size Support new Field data types of Large Object Support only I and S options for LF command new Command Option X to allow the read of the extended FDT Extend Long Alphas to specify lengths > 253 and < 16K Positioned for the future e.g.Date/Time formats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    39. 26-May-12 Enhanced Direct Call Interface Needed for RBL > 32K Needed for LOBs Needed for segmented Record Buffers Format Buffers will map the Record Buffers; 1:1 Increased number of Command Option fields Increased number of Additions Field Increased size for User area Positioned for the future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    41. 26-May-12 Enhanced Direct Call Interface Adabas Calling Procedure between V7 and V8 User exits 1 and 4 will be replaced by exits 11 and 14 Original ACB will still be supported Nucleus will primarily run in ACBX mode Conversion normally performed during router logic New Adalinks will no longer be provided in source form New ACBX interface required only with new features Adabas v8 Lifting Limits

    45. 26-May-12 Adabas System Manager features Browser front end for low footprint Web base technology for the central control of: Database and other Administration (AOS/ABS, WCP, REV) Session Monitoring (ADA, REV) Trend analysis (ASF/REV) Single standard interface to manage Adabas, Net-work, Tamino, Entire Communicator and various database add-on tools and utilities similar look and feel across platforms and products Facilities for both mainframe and Workstation products (e.g. Adabas 8 on the mainframe and Adabas 5 on Open systems) Same tool for Adabas on different platforms, hides underlying functionality differences Adabas Manager

    46. 26-May-12 Adabas System Manager features Advancements: Text in colour Use of GUI/GIF images (e.g. Pie, Bar, Curve) Language support Standardized Paging facility Drop Box option for command list or display options Column Sorting Search with page facility Flexible Column selection Icon usage Agent Filtering Standardization in column specification and alignment Adabas Manager
